Description : bootstrap a basic RPM-based system
rpmstrap is a tool for bootstrapping a basic RPM-based system. It is inspired
by debootstrap, and allows you to build chroots and basic systems from RPM
sources.
.
At present rpmstrap can build basic Fedora Core 2, Fedora Core 3, Fedora Core
4, Yellowdog 4, CentOS 3, CentOS 4, Mandriva and Scientific Linux systems. It
also has support for custom RPM-based systems managed by PDK.
